/*
* Separate free lists are maintained for different sized objects
* up to MAXOBJSZ.
* The call GC_allocobj(i,k) ensures that the freelist for
* kind k objects of size i points to a non-empty
* free list. It returns a pointer to the first entry on the free list.
* In a single-threaded world, GC_allocobj may be called to allocate
* an object of (small) size i as follows:
*
* opp = &(GC_objfreelist[i]);
* if (*opp == 0) GC_allocobj(i, NORMAL);
* ptr = *opp;
* *opp = obj_link(ptr);
*
* Note that this is very fast if the free list is non-empty; it should
* only involve the execution of 4 or 5 simple instructions.
* All composite objects on freelists are cleared, except for
* their first word.
*/
/*
* The allocator uses GC_allochblk to allocate large chunks of objects.
* These chunks all start on addresses which are multiples of
* HBLKSZ. Each allocated chunk has an associated header,
* which can be located quickly based on the address of the chunk.
* (See headers.c for details.)
* This makes it possible to check quickly whether an
* arbitrary address corresponds to an object administered by the
* allocator.
*/

/* Return the number of words allocated, adjusted for explicit storage */
/* management, etc.. This number is used in deciding when to trigger */
/* collections. */
word GC_adj_words_allocd()
{
register signed_word result;
register signed_word expl_managed =
BYTES_TO_WORDS((long)GC_non_gc_bytes
- (long)GC_non_gc_bytes_at_gc);
/* Don't count what was explicitly freed, or newly allocated for */
/* explicit management. Note that deallocating an explicitly */
/* managed object should not alter result, assuming the client */
/* is playing by the rules. */
result = (signed_word)GC_words_allocd
- (signed_word)GC_mem_freed - expl_managed;
if (result > (signed_word)GC_words_allocd) {
result = GC_words_allocd;
/* probably client bug or unfortunate scheduling */
}
result += GC_words_finalized;
/* We count objects enqueued for finalization as though they */
/* had been reallocated this round. Finalization is user */
/* visible progress. And if we don't count this, we have */
/* stability problems for programs that finalize all objects. */
result += GC_words_wasted;
/* This doesn't reflect useful work. But if there is lots of */
/* new fragmentation, the same is probably true of the heap, */
/* and the collection will be correspondingly cheaper. */
if (result < (signed_word)(GC_words_allocd >> 3)) {
/* Always count at least 1/8 of the allocations. We don't want */
/* to collect too infrequently, since that would inhibit */
/* coalescing of free storage blocks. */
/* This also makes us partially robust against client bugs. */
return(GC_words_allocd >> 3);
} else {
return(result);
}
}
